Nectarine Chutney

I had some nectarine lying in my refrigerator so i tried this sweet and tangy chutney.This chutney is very easy to make and different.It can be serve as a side dish with any type of meal.

Ingredients,

Ripe nectarine -3-4
ginger - 1/2 inch pieces
green chilly - 1-2
sugar - 4-5 tbsp
salt to taste
Red chilli powder- 1/2 tbsp
Crushed black pepper- 1/4 tbsp
A pinch of Garam masala
little water

Method

1-Cut nectarine and take out the seed,chop it along with green chillies and ginger into very small pieces.

2-Heat little water(about 3-4 tbsp) in a pan and add sugar ,let it dissolve.

3-Add chopped nectarine along with chilli and ginger ,stir ,cover it and let it cook in steam for 1/2 an hour on low heat.(stir 2-3 times in between)

4- After it uncover , add all spices ,mash little bit and cover it again for 15 minutes.

5-Stir and let it cool ,store in glass jar ,this chutney can be store for about 2-3 weeks in refrigerator .

Indian spicy crackers

All time hit,spicy crackers which is fit for anytime munching .Perfect for take along for travel and picnics and can be store for more than a month.

Ingredients,

All purpose flour - 1 cup
Semolina -1/4 cup
 oil-       4-5 tbsp
red chilli powder- 1 tsp
carom seeds- 1/2 tbsp
salt to taste
onion seeds (kalongi)-1/2 tsp (optional)
oil for deep frying

Method-

1-Combine all the ingredients except oil for frying and make a stiff dough.

2-Let it sit for 15-20 minutes.

3-Knead it well again and make 3-4 equal size balls and roll one by one  and cut it into wedges.

4-Heat oil in a deep pan and fry these wedges on medium low heat for about 10-15 minutes or till golden brown.

5-Let them cool and store in a air tight container ,serve with pickle any type of chutney .

Kaju Masala (Cashew nuts curry)

A curry with a royal touch ,a hit in any party and easy too.Cashew nuts in a spicy gravy with whole garam masala imparts a very nice aroma.It goes well with any Indian bread like roti,naan or puris.

Ingredients -

Cashew nuts - 1/2 cup (wholes and halves)
Raisins- 1/4 cup or less
Tomato -1big size
onion - 1 medium size
Capsicum-1/2 small size
cloves- 2 nos
peppercorns- 2 nos
black cardamom -1
green cardamom - 2
Cinnamon stick -1/2 inch piece
Bay leaf - 1
red chilli powder- 1/2 tsp or according to taste
coriander powder-1 tbsp
Turmeric powder-1tbsp
cumin seeds- 1 tbsp
milk-1/2 cup or less
Desi ghee - 2 tbsp
salt to taste

Method-

1-Chop onion,tomato and capsicum very finely.
2-Soak raisins in milk .
3-Heat ghee in a wok and add cumin seeds ,let them splutter.
4-Add all whole spices and roast them a minute till the nice aroma comes out.
5-Add finely chopped onions and saute on low heat ,add some salt.
6-Add finely chopped tomato and saute till oil separates then add capsicum and saute till capsicum gets little tender.
7-Add turmeric powder,coriander powder and red chilli powder to masala.
8- Now add cashew nuts and soaked raisins (reserve the milk for later.)
9-Add little water ,stir and cook it covered for about 10 minutes.
10-Then add milk in which we soaked raisins and just give it a boil uncoverd.
11- Garnish with cilantro and serve hot.

Aaloo Wadiyan

Aloo (Potatoes)goes very well in any kind of preparations at any time,so i always keeps  boiled potatoes in my refrigerator ,they are very useful in the times when you are in hurry or not in mood of elevorate cooking (It happens sometimes rite: )

Aloo Wadiyan is also a comfort kindda curry for me which goes well with paranthas and wholesome in itself with daal wadis.In my previous post 'Wadi ka paani' ,i mentioned that you can easily get wadis in Indian Grocery stores.(My mother and grandmother makes it at home too).

Ingredients:


Potato - 1 medium size (Boiled )
Masala wadis- 4-5
Tomato Puree-1/4 cup
Ginger garlic paste- 1/2 tsp
Salt to taste
Cumin seed -1/2 tbsp
Turmeric powder- 1/2 tsp
Oil
1/4 cup water
Cilantro for garnishing 

Method-

1-Break the wadis in to pieces and shallow fry them in little oil till golden brown.

2-Cook wadis in pressure cooker with little water till soft (about 4-5 whistles)

3-Peel the potato and cut into pieces.

4-In a pan heat little oil,add cumin seeds and let it splutter.

5-Add ginger garlic paste saute for sometime ,add  Turmeric powder ,tomato puree and cook till oil separates.

6-Add potato pieces,salt and cooked wadiyan along with water ,boil it till desired consistency .

7-Garnish with cilantro and serve hot with parantha.
Note- 1- No need to add any other spices as wadis has all spices in it.

Microwave Sweet Saffron rice (Zarda)

Sweet Rice is a traditional dish of festivals in our house.My grandmother use to make it on 'Basant Panchmi' festival mainly.she use to make it in her own traditional way(on stove top),but i tried it in my Microwave and it came out perfectly well.Microwave sweet rice is a easy,quick one pot meal ,a perfect dessert after any meal .  

The look and smell of saffron rice is delicious and tempting. It can be serve  cold or warm. (we like it warm)


Ingredients: 

1/2 cup basmati  rice
2 tbsp ghee or butter
1  cup water
2 tbsp milk
1/4cup sugar or more
Few  saffron threads
1/2 teaspoon coarsely crushed cardamom seeds
3 tbsp  pistachios,Melon seeds,and cashews and almonds (few for garnishing)
10-14 raisins 
 1/2 tsp turmeric

Method-

1-Soak rice in water for at least 1/2 hour.

2-soak saffron threads and turmeric in milk and keep aside.

3-Cook rice in microwave with water for 10 minutes,stir occasionally after every 2-3 minutes.

4-Strain access water (if any)  and leave rice for 10 minutes.

5-Add saffron-turmeric  milk and microwave for 2 minutes.

6-Now add sugar and cardamon and microwave for 2-3 more minutes.

7-Add ghee or butter along with all dry fruits and microwave it for one more minute.

8-Sweet Saffron rice is ready,serve it warm or cold by garnishing it with few more dry fruits on top.

Cumin Bread (Jeera bread)

This was my first attempt to make bread at home and believe me it came out so well and tasty, that i myself could not believe it .......Before attempting bread making at home ,I Googled so many recipes and finally found this one in one of the blog which was looking perfect in terms of measurement and Ingredients and most of all its cumin bread a perfect Indian taste......so here comes the recipe


Ingredients: 

1cups all purpose flour
1/2 cup wheat flour
1/2 cup water
1 tea spn cumin seeds (roasted)
 1and 1/4 tea spn active dry yeast
1/2 tbl spn unsalted butter
1/2 tea spn sugar
1 tea spn salt
Olive oil


Method-

1-Roast cumin seeds till a nice aroma comes out of them. Crush them slightly(do not make a powder).

2-Heat the water till it is lukewarm, Add sugar, butter and little olive oil. Then add yeast to it. Leave it at a warm place for 10mins till yeast becomes active (the mixture becomes frothy)


3-Add salt, cumin and flours. If necessary add a little more water. Make a dough.(Knead it well for about 10mins.)

4-Transfer the dough to a well oiled big vessel. Cover with a plastic wrap.

5-Leave it for about 1 and 1/2 hrs – 2hrs till the dough doubles in size.

6-Take out the dough on a flat surface. Press down the dough. Knead for a minute and give desired shape.

7-Apply some olive oil on top and leave it covered for another 45mins. The dough should double in size again.


8-Preheat the oven at 500F for about 10mins. Bake the bread for about 10- 15mins. Take it out and brush some butter on top. Then keep it back in oven and bake till you get a nice brown color(about 10- 15mins).


I served it with a simple olive oil-dried basil-salt mixture (like they serve in some of the Italian restaurants here). It was a very crusty from outside, soft from inside.

Mango Lassi

Lassis are  traditional Punjabi beverage which blend yogurt with water, salt, and spices into a cooling summer drink. Wikipedia says the idea of making sweet lassis with fruit is a relatively recent variation, but the mango flavor is  so delightful in this that I truly can't imagine the drink without it. Mangoes are native to India, and more than 50% of the world's mangoes are grown in India.

Summer is no fun without mangoes and here is one sweet lassi recipe which so refreshing and perfect for hot summer days.


Ingredients:

Mango -1 or mango pulp -1/2 cup

 Yogurt(fresh) 1 cup

Sugar 1 tbsp or as needed

Green cardamon powder a pinch

Saffron  2-3 strands

1/2 cup crushed ice cubes


Method-


1-Peel the mango skin and separate the pulp from the seed. Discard seed.(omit this step if using mango pulp.)

2-Combine all the ingredients in a mixer/blender and blend till smooth and serve chilled.




 Note- Do not add sugar if using sweetened mango pulp.

Rajma Masala (Kidney Beans Curry)

I enjoy cooking lentils and beans  and there is always a myriad of dried and canned beans in my pantry.What makes them even better is that they come in a wonderful variety. Black beans, pinto beans, white kidney beans, brown lentils, chickpeas, black-eyed peas, soybeans. Each has a distinct flavor and texture that lends itself to different dishes and uses. Beans plays an very important role in Indian as well as other cuisine also in different forms.
Red kidney beans are very nutritious. They are, however, harder to digest than other beans, which is why they're traditionally cooked with seasonings that help break them down, such as ginger in Indian cooking.Here I am giving you the recipe of red kidney beans curry which combines well with Jeera rice and phulkas.



Ingredients


1  cup red kidney beans or use canned one
4  cups water
2  medium onions finely chopped or pureed
2  bay leaves
2  tbsp ginger - garlic paste
½  tsp  asafoetida and turmeric powder (optional)
1  tsp cumin seed
2  tsp red chili powder
2  big tomatoes pureed
1  tsp garam Masala
2  tbsp coriander powder
tbsp oil
salt to taste 
     coriander leaves for garnishing    


Method -

1- Soak kidney beans in water for overnite,if not using canned one. 
   
  2-Drain  red kidney beans and wash them well. Place them in a pressure cooker (for speedy cooking). Add  water and some salt. Close the cooker and cook on high heat. After one whistle, cook on low heat for about 10  minutes or till the beans are soft. 

3-Heat oil in a heavy-bottomed pan on medium heat and crackle the cumin seeds. Add  bay leaves , asafoetida and  ginger-garlic paste. Fry briefly. Add onions and salt  saute till they  golden brown. Add all the spice powders except garam masala .

4-Add  tomato puree, Fry till the oil separates. Add the cooked red kidney beans , mix well,cover and cook on medium heat for about 15  minutes.


5-Finally add garam masala and garish it with cilantro,serve hot.


Note--While cooking dry beans can be all day affair, canned beans are a quick substitute. Just be sure to drain and rinse them, which helps lower the sodium content.
